Bing‐Xing Pan
About
Bing‐Xing Pan has authored 63 papers that have received a total of 1.6k indexed citations.
This includes 27 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 24 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ience and 21 papers in Behavioral Neuroscience. The topics of these papers are Stress Responses and Cortisol (21 papers),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(20 papers) and Memory and Neural Mechanisms (18 papers). Bing‐Xing Pan is often cited by papers focused on Stress Responses and Cortisol (21 papers),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(20 papers) and Memory and Neural Mechanisms (18 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Japan. Bing‐Xing Pan's co-authors include Ye He, Junyu Zhang, Wen-Hua Zhang, Wei-Zhu Liu and Ping Hu and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Advanced Materials and Neuron.
